1. A Deep Connection to His Heritage
Born in Honolulu, Hawaii, on August 1, 1979, Jason Momoa is of mixed ancestry, with Native Hawaiian, German, and Irish roots. His deep connection to his Native Hawaiian heritage is evident in his advocacy for indigenous rights and environmental conservation. Momoa actively supports causes that promote cultural preservation and sustainability, reflecting his passion for his ancestral roots.
2. From Lifeguard to Leading Man
Before his breakout role as Khal Drogo in Game of Thrones, Momoa worked as a lifeguard in his native Hawaii. His early career also included modeling gigs, where his rugged looks and imposing physique caught the eye of casting directors. This background in physicality and outdoor pursuits influences his roles and personal interests to this day.
